How to get rid of the display of the parent template in ember js?

Good evening! Tuning of Rue, like this:
this.route('news', function() {
this.route('add');
 this.route('news-item', {
 path: '/:news-item_id'
 }, function() {
this.route('edit');
});
 });


I noticed a thing that when you go to the page for adding news, I have still displayed and the parent template of "news". How can it be removed?
July 2nd 19 at 14:26
1 answer
July 2nd 19 at 14:28
Solution
Hi.

Get the list of news is not news, and in news.index

Will look like this:

// templates/news.hbs
{{outlet}}


// templates/news/index.hbs
// Output list news


// templates/news/news-item.hbs
// Output one news
Works. From a template, the default index will provide the content? - yoshiko_Corwin15 commented on July 2nd 19 at 14:31
Yes, it works so

news/ -> news.hbs/index.hbs
news/add -> news.hbs/add.hbs
news/43 -> news.hbs/news-item.hbs - Dallas.Rosenbaum commented on July 2nd 19 at 14:34
: Huge SPS. Where I have not googled. - yoshiko_Corwin15 commented on July 2nd 19 at 14:37

Find more questions by tags Ember.js